Alpha Arbutin Dark Spot Corrector

Alpha arbutin has quietly become one of the most effective and well-tolerated brightening ingredients in modern skincare — a stable, skin-safe derivative of hydroquinone that inhibits melanin production without the irritation or regulatory concerns that come with its parent compound. Whether you’re targeting post-acne marks, sun spots, or uneven skin tone, a well-formulated alpha arbutin serum delivers visible results without compromising your skin barrier. Buyer’s Guide: Alpha Arbutin Dark Spot Correctors

Concentration Matters: Research supports alpha arbutin efficacy beginning at 1% and showing clear results at 2%. Products that don’t disclose their alpha arbutin percentage may be using it as a label claim rather than an active treatment dose. The Ordinary’s 2% is the clearest efficacy benchmark — if a competing product doesn’t specify its concentration, assume it’s lower.

Formulation pH and Stability: Alpha arbutin is stable at pH 3.5–6.5. Products formulated in high-pH bases (above 7) will degrade the ingredient before it reaches your skin. Check that brightening serums have an appropriate acidic to neutral pH — many brands publish this on their website or packaging. Opaque or dark packaging also protects alpha arbutin from light degradation.

SPF Is Non-Negotiable: Every brightening active — alpha arbutin, niacinamide, vitamin C — is undermined by unprotected UV exposure, which re-triggers melanin production faster than any serum can suppress it. Apply a minimum SPF 30 broad-spectrum sunscreen every morning as the final step in your brightening routine. Without it, you’re working against yourself regardless of which serum you choose.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does alpha arbutin take to show results?

Most users see measurable improvement in dark spots after 4–8 weeks of consistent daily use. Fresh post-acne marks (post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ation) respond faster — sometimes within 3–4 weeks — while older, deeper sun spots may take 10–12 weeks of consistent use. Daily SPF use is essential during this period to prevent UV from restimulating the pigmentation you’re trying to suppress.

Can I use alpha arbutin with retinol?

Yes — this is actually a highly effective combination. Use alpha arbutin in the morning (under SPF) and retinol in the evening. Retinol accelerates cell turnover, helping cleared pigmented cells shed faster, while alpha arbutin suppresses new melanin production. Together they address both the existing discoloration and the ongoing production cycle. Avoid applying both in the same step if your skin is sensitive.

Is alpha arbutin safe for dark skin tones?

Yes — alpha arbutin is considered safer for darker skin tones than hydroquinone, which can cause paradoxical darkening (ochronosis) with long-term overuse in some individuals. Alpha arbutin inhibits melanin production temporarily and reversibly without the risks associated with stronger prescription depigmenting agents. It’s widely used and recommended across all Fitzpatrick skin types.

Should I use alpha arbutin in the morning or evening?

Either or both — alpha arbutin is photostable and not degraded by UV exposure the way some vitamin C forms are. Most dermatologists recommend morning use followed by SPF for maximum anti-pigmentation protection, since you’re suppressing melanin production during the period of UV exposure. Evening use is equally valid and some users find it easier to layer with their PM routine. Twice-daily use is safe and generally more effective than once daily.
